The Book of Titus
Chapter 3: Verse 9
A comparison of various English translations and the sources they are derived from.

Contents

[edit] Wycliffe (Tite)

And eschewe thou foltische questiouns, and genologies, and stryues, and fiytyngis of the lawe; for tho ben vnprofitable and veyn.

[edit] 1769 King James Version

But avoid foolish questions, and genealogies, and contentions, and strivings about the law; for they are unprofitable and vain.

[edit] American Standard Version

but shun foolish questionings, and genealogies, and strifes, and fightings about law; for they are unprofitable and vain.

[edit] World English Bible

but shun foolish questionings, genealogies, strife, and disputes about the law; for they are unprofitable and vain.
